Understanding Canva Teams: More Than Just a Design Upgrade

Canva Teams is a paid subscription plan that offers a range of enhanced features and benefits compared to the free version. It’s designed specifically for teams and businesses, providing a collaborative design environment for projects of all sizes.
Here’s a breakdown of the key features and benefits of Canva Teams:

  • Shared Brand Templates: Create and store brand templates, ensuring consistency across all your designs.
  • Team Folders: Organize your team’s projects and designs into dedicated folders for easy access and collaboration.
  • Brand Kit: Establish a central hub for your brand’s colors, fonts, logos, and other assets, ensuring a consistent visual identity.
  • Content Library: Gain access to a larger library of premium templates, photos, and illustrations.
  • Collaboration Tools: Work seamlessly with your team members on design projects, providing real-time feedback and edits.
  • Advanced Features: Enjoy access to advanced features like design grids, custom fonts, and brand approval workflows.
  • Unlimited Storage: Store your designs and assets without worrying about storage limitations.
  • Team Management: Manage team members, roles, and permissions, controlling access to specific projects and resources.

Comparing Canva Teams to the Free Version: Is It Worth the Investment?

The free version of Canva offers a decent range of features, including access to basic templates, design elements, and collaboration tools. However, it has limitations that can hinder the productivity and efficiency of teams and businesses:

  • Limited Storage: The free version has a limited storage capacity for designs and assets.
  • Basic Templates: Access to premium templates and design elements is restricted.
  • Limited Collaboration Features: Collaboration features are basic and may not meet the requirements of larger teams.
  • No Brand Consistency: Lack of brand kits and shared templates can lead to inconsistent design branding.

Canva Teams offers significant advantages over the free version:

  • Enhanced Collaboration: Streamlined collaboration features allow teams to work together efficiently.
  • Brand Consistency: Brand kits and shared templates ensure consistent branding across all designs.
  • Unlimited Storage: No need to worry about storage limitations for designs and assets.
  • Access to Premium Content: Enjoy a wider selection of premium templates, photos, and illustrations.
